Understanding the Importance of Timely Detection

Early detection is key when it comes to water leaks. Even a seemingly minor leak can cause significant damage over time:

  • Structural Damage: Leaking pipes can weaken walls, foundations, and floors, leading to costly repairs or even structural instability.
  • Mold Growth: Moisture fosters mold growth, which not only damages your property but also poses serious health risks to you and your family.
  • High Water Bills: Unchecked leaks can drastically increase your monthly water bills, representing a financial burden.

How to Detect Water Leaks in Everett: A Step-by-Step Approach

In the everett area, with its varying climate and plumbing systems, knowing the signs of a leak is essential for proactive maintenance. Here’s how you can effectively detect water leaks:

1. Monitor Your Water Bills

  • Unusual Spikes: Do your water bills suddenly jump without any apparent reason? This could indicate a hidden leak. Compare your current bills to past averages to pinpoint anomalies.

  • Keep Records: Track your water usage patterns throughout the year. This will help you establish a baseline for normal consumption, making it easier to identify discrepancies.

2. Check for Visible Signs

  • Moisture or Water Stains: Inspect your walls, ceilings, and floors for any signs of moisture or water damage. Pay close attention to areas around fixtures, pipes, and appliances.

  • Musty Odors: Persistent moldy smells, especially in dark or seldom-used spaces, can signal hidden water leaks.

  • Sound of Dripping Water: Even a tiny drip can eventually become a significant leak. Listen carefully for the telltale sound of dripping water anywhere in your home.

3. Examine Your Plumbing System

  • Inspect Pipes: Look for exposed pipes and check for rust, corrosion, or signs of damage. These could indicate leaks or potential problems.

  • Check for Leaking Fixtures: Pay close attention to faucets, showerheads, and toilets. Tighten loose connections and repair any obvious leaks immediately.

  • Examine Appliances: Your water heater, washing machine, and dishwasher can be significant sources of leaks. Inspect them regularly for any signs of moisture or damage.

Signs of a Hidden Water Leak in Everett

Not all leaks are immediately visible. Recognize these subtle signs that may indicate a hidden leak:

  • Discolored Walls or Ceilings: Look for patches of discoloration on walls and ceilings, which could signal water damage behind drywall.

  • Swelling or Warping: Inspect doors, windows, and flooring for swelling or warping. These can be signs of moisture penetration from a hidden leak.

  • Unusual Musty Smells: If you detect a persistent moldy smell without visible moisture, it might indicate a leak in a hard-to-reach area.

Preventing Water Damage from Leaks in Everett

Prevention is key to avoiding the costly and stressful aftermath of water damage. Implement these measures to minimize your risk:

  • Regular Maintenance: Schedule regular inspections of your plumbing system, including checking for leaks, inspecting pipes for corrosion, and maintaining pressure regulators.

  • Insulate Pipes: Protect exposed pipes from extreme temperatures by insulating them, especially in unheated areas like basements and attics.

  • Fix Leaks Promptly: Address any leaks, no matter how small, immediately to prevent further damage and water waste.

  • Use Water-Saving Devices: Install low-flow showerheads, faucets, and toilets to reduce water consumption and pressure on your plumbing system.
